色综合老司机第九色激情 _中文字幕日韩av资源站_国产+人+亚洲_久久久精品影院_久久久视频免费观看_欧美激情亚洲自拍_亚洲成av人片在线观看香蕉_热草久综合在线_欧美极品第一页_2020国产精品自拍

千鋒教育-做有情懷、有良心、有品質的職業教育機構

手機站
千鋒教育

千鋒學習站 | 隨時隨地免費學

千鋒教育

掃一掃進入千鋒手機站

領取全套視頻
千鋒教育

關注千鋒學習站小程序
隨時隨地免費學習課程

當前位置:首頁  >  技術干貨  > 12個解決日常問題的JavaScript代碼片段

12個解決日常問題的JavaScript代碼片段

來源:千鋒教育
發布人:wjy
時間: 2022-06-01 12:12:00 1654056720

  12 個有用的JavaScript片段,希望通過這些代碼的學習,加快開發速度并節省時間!

12個解決日常問題的JavaScript代碼片段

  ## **1、破壞賦值**

  在 JavaScript 中,您可以使用析構方法將數組中的值解包并將它們分配給其他變量。

  ```js

  // 1. Destructive Assignment

  const data = ["Paul", "too old", "Software Engineer"]

  const [name, age, job_title] = data

  console.log(name, age, job_title) // Paul too old Software Engineer

  ```

  ## **2、在Array中查找對象**

  JavaScript find() 方法可用于搜索數組以查找特定對象。

  ```js

  // 2. Find an object in Array

  const employess = [

  {name: "Paul", job_title: "Software Engineer"},

  {name: "Peter", job_title: "Web Developer"},

  {name: "Harald", job_title: "Screen Designer"},

  ]

  let sen = employess.find(data => data.job_title === "Software Engineer")

  console.log(sen) // { name: 'Paul', job_title: 'Software Engineer' }

  ```

  ## **3、反轉字符串**

  以下代碼段可用于在不使用循環的情況下反轉任何字符串。

  ```js

  // 3. Reverse a String

  const reverse = (input) => {

  return input.split("").reverse().join("");

  }

  console.log(reverse("Paul Knulst")) // tslunK luaP

  console.log(reverse("Medium is awesome")) // emosewa si muideM

  ```

  ## **4、帶有占位符的模板文字**

  如果您使用模板文字,您可以借助 ${} 方法在字符串中包含變量。

  ```js

  // 4. Placeholder in Strings

  let placeholder1 = "Engineer";

  let placeholder2 = "Developer";

  console.log(`I'm a Software ${placeholder1}`); // I'm a Software Engineer

  console.log(`I'm a Software ${placeholder2}`); // I'm a Software Developer

  ```

  ## **5、單行if-else語句**

  對于 JavaScript 中的簡單 if-else 語句,您可以使用單行方法來執行它。

  ```js

  // 5. One-Line if-else Statement

  // normal

  if (13 > 37) {

  console.log(true);

  } else {

  console.log(false)

  }

  // One liner

  13 > 37 ? console.log(true) : console.log(false)

  ```

  ## **6、擺脫重復**

  在 JavaScript 中,有一種簡單的方法可以從任何輸入數組中去除重復項。當數組中有很多元素并且可能有一些重復項時,這非常方便。

  以下代碼段將展示如何使用 Set 數據類型來實現此目的

  ```js

  // 6. Get Rid of Duplicates

  function removeDuplicates(array) {

  return [...new Set(array)];

  }

  const uniqueStr = removeDuplicates(["Paul", "John", "Harald", "Paul", "John"])

  const uniqueNr = removeDuplicates([1, 1, 2, 2, 3, 3, 4, 5, 6, 7, 7, 7, 9])

  console.log(uniqueStr) // [ 'Paul', 'John', 'Harald' ]

  console.log(uniqueNr) // [1, 2, 3, 4, 5, 6, 7, 9]

  ```

  ## **7、將字符串拆分為數組**

  如果您想將字符串拆分為數組,可以使用以下代碼片段

  ```js

  // 7. Split String to Array

  const randomString = "Software"

  const newArray = [...randomString]

  console.log(newArray) // ['S', 'o', 'f', 't', 'w', 'a', 'r', 'e']

  ```

  ## **8、捕獲右鍵單擊**

  如果使用 JavaScript 并希望在用戶使用時捕獲右鍵單擊以執行某些代碼。

  ```js

  // 8. Capture Right Click

  // only usable in HTML/JS

  window.oncontextmenu = () => {console.log("Right Click is Pressed!")}

  ```

  ## **9、遍歷鍵和值**

  這個有用的片段可用于迭代字典數據的鍵(或值)。為此,您可以檢索鍵/值并使用 forEach 函數。

  ```js

  // 9. Looping through Keys and Values

  const programming_languages = {JavaScript: 1, Kotlin: 2, Python: 3};

  Object.keys(programming_languages).forEach((key) => {

  console.log(key);

  });

  // JavaScript

  // Kotlin

  // Python

  Object.values(programming_languages).forEach((key) => {

  console.log(key);

  });

  // 1

  // 2

  // 3

  ```

  ## **10、智能數據過濾**

  使用 JavaScript 內置的 Filter 方法過濾您的數據。如果您的輸入有大量數據并且您只需要輸入數組中的特定數據,這很重要。

  ```js

  // 10. Smart Data Filteration

  const jobs = ["Frontend Developer", "Backend Developer", "Data Scientist", "Teacher"]

  const filtered_jobs1 = jobs.filter(data => data.length < 10)

  const filtered_jobs2 = jobs.filter(data => data.includes("Developer"))

  console.log(filtered_jobs1) // [ 'Teacher' ]

  console.log(filtered_jobs2) // [ 'Frontend Developer', 'Backend Developer' ]

  ```

  ## **11、空合并運算符**

  空合并運算符 (??) 是一個邏輯運算符,當其左側操作數為空或未定義時返回其右側操作數,否則返回其左側操作數。

  ```js

  // 11. Nullish coalescing operator

  const foo = null ?? 'default string';

  const baz = 0 ?? 42;

  console.log(foo); // default string

  console.log(baz); // 0

  ```

  ## **12、錯誤處理**

  在編程中,開發過程中總會發生錯誤。為了避免您的程序崩潰,您可以使用 try-catch 語句。這是每個編程語言中的一種眾所周知的語法,用于捕獲運行時錯誤。

  ```js

  // 12. Error Handling

  function getRectArea(width, height) {

  if (isNaN(width) || isNaN(height)) {

  throw 'Parameter is not a number!';

  }

  }

  try {

  getRectArea(3, "A")

  } catch (err) {

  console.log(`There was an error: ${err}`)

  } finally {

  console.log("This code block is executed regardless of try/catch results")

  }

  // Output:

  // There was an error: Parameter is not a number!

  // This code block is executed regardless of try/catch results

  ```

  **-** **End** **-**

  更多關于“html5培訓”的問題,歡迎咨詢千鋒教育在線名師。千鋒已有十余年的培訓經驗,課程大綱更科學更專業,有針對零基礎的就業班,有針對想提升技術的提升班,高品質課程助理你實現夢想。

tags:
聲明:本站稿件版權均屬千鋒教育所有,未經許可不得擅自轉載。
10年以上業內強師集結,手把手帶你蛻變精英
請您保持通訊暢通,專屬學習老師24小時內將與您1V1溝通
免費領取
今日已有369人領取成功
劉同學 138****2860 剛剛成功領取
王同學 131****2015 剛剛成功領取
張同學 133****4652 剛剛成功領取
李同學 135****8607 剛剛成功領取
楊同學 132****5667 剛剛成功領取
岳同學 134****6652 剛剛成功領取
梁同學 157****2950 剛剛成功領取
劉同學 189****1015 剛剛成功領取
張同學 155****4678 剛剛成功領取
鄒同學 139****2907 剛剛成功領取
董同學 138****2867 剛剛成功領取
周同學 136****3602 剛剛成功領取
相關推薦HOT
開班信息
北京校區
  • 北京校區
  • 大連校區
  • 廣州校區
  • 成都校區
  • 杭州校區
  • 長沙校區
  • 合肥校區
  • 南京校區
  • 上海校區
  • 深圳校區
  • 武漢校區
  • 鄭州校區
  • 西安校區
  • 青島校區
  • 重慶校區
  • 太原校區
  • 沈陽校區
  • 南昌校區
  • 哈爾濱校區
色综合老司机第九色激情 _中文字幕日韩av资源站_国产+人+亚洲_久久久精品影院_久久久视频免费观看_欧美激情亚洲自拍_亚洲成av人片在线观看香蕉_热草久综合在线_欧美极品第一页_2020国产精品自拍
色8久久人人97超碰香蕉987| 一本色道久久综合狠狠躁的推荐| 亚洲观看高清完整版在线观看| 国产不卡免费视频| 日韩av不卡一区二区| 欧美本精品男人aⅴ天堂| 美女www一区二区| 国产精品乱人伦中文| 欧美日韩在线免费视频| 成人黄色777网| 国产欧美一区二区在线| 91精品国产麻豆国产自产在线| 久久99精品久久久久| 国产女人18毛片水真多成人如厕| 欧美日韩一区三区| bt7086福利一区国产| 激情欧美日韩一区二区| 亚洲高清久久久| 中文字幕亚洲精品在线观看| 日韩欧美你懂的| 成人综合婷婷国产精品久久蜜臀 | 丝袜诱惑制服诱惑色一区在线观看 | 在线观看国产一区二区| 亚洲视频一区在线观看| 欧美成人女星排行榜| 777xxx欧美| 欧美日韩电影一区| 国产福利91精品一区| 六月婷婷色综合| 青青草国产精品亚洲专区无| 久久久久久久久久美女| 91亚洲国产成人精品一区二区三 | 免费xxxx性欧美18vr| 久久综合色天天久久综合图片| 欧美色网一区二区| 午夜久久久久久久久| 亚洲桃色在线一区| 国产欧美精品区一区二区三区| 粉嫩aⅴ一区二区三区四区五区| 韩国中文字幕2020精品| 成人手机在线视频| 91免费看`日韩一区二区| 99精品久久99久久久久| 久久久91精品国产一区二区精品| caoporn国产一区二区| 狠狠色2019综合网| 欧美一区二区视频网站| 日韩女优制服丝袜电影| 91精品一区二区三区在线观看| 亚洲电影视频在线| 欧美色精品天天在线观看视频| 成人精品gif动图一区| 一区二区理论电影在线观看| 国产精品综合在线视频| 欧美性大战xxxxx久久久| 日韩精品一区二区三区四区视频| 91香蕉视频在线| 精品国产免费人成在线观看| 亚洲精品视频免费看| 国产一区二区三区免费播放| 99久久婷婷国产精品综合| 91免费看`日韩一区二区| 日韩免费观看2025年上映的电影 | 一区二区三区四区高清精品免费观看 | 精品久久五月天| 日本女人一区二区三区| 毛片av一区二区三区| 91成人免费在线| 国内精品在线播放| 日韩欧美亚洲一区二区| 亚洲电影一区二区| 3atv一区二区三区| 国产精品一级黄| 国产精品免费久久| 91免费观看国产| 国产成人免费xxxxxxxx| 国产精品久久久久久久久免费樱桃 | 激情五月激情综合网| 91精品国产综合久久久久久漫画| 亚洲靠逼com| 欧美一区二区免费观在线| 日韩av一级片| 国产精品久久久久久久第一福利 | 国产精品一卡二| 琪琪久久久久日韩精品| 中文字幕精品一区| 欧美日韩国产综合一区二区三区| 五月天国产精品| 91九色02白丝porn| 久久久777精品电影网影网 | 日韩黄色在线观看| 久久女同性恋中文字幕| 97精品久久久久中文字幕| 久久精品视频免费| 精品国产欧美一区二区| 成人黄色片在线观看| 一区二区三区在线观看网站| 欧美在线不卡一区| 91麻豆精品国产91久久久| 捆绑变态av一区二区三区| 国产精品一区一区三区| 91视频.com| 欧美一级久久久久久久大片| 国产亚洲一区二区三区四区| 91精品国产91热久久久做人人| zzijzzij亚洲日本少妇熟睡| 色老头久久综合| 91在线视频免费观看| 国产成人av电影在线播放| 色诱视频网站一区| 欧洲日韩一区二区三区| 国产人妖乱国产精品人妖| 亚州成人在线电影| av在线这里只有精品| 久久久午夜精品理论片中文字幕| 亚洲精品一区二区三区在线观看| 久久精品国产在热久久| 欧美一区二区日韩一区二区| 亚洲成人激情自拍| 欧美日韩久久不卡| 亚洲成人av中文| 欧美一卡在线观看| 国产精品亚洲第一区在线暖暖韩国| 色综合天天综合网天天狠天天| 国产精品福利av| 在线观看免费亚洲| 欧美激情一区不卡| 欧美亚洲国产一区二区三区| 亚洲欧美国产77777| 欧美性做爰猛烈叫床潮| 日本欧美一区二区三区| 欧美性感一类影片在线播放| 韩国精品在线观看| 亚洲天堂精品在线观看| 欧美肥妇bbw| 国产成人啪免费观看软件| 精品三级在线观看| 91国模大尺度私拍在线视频| 国产一区二区在线看| 亚洲综合自拍偷拍| 久久蜜臀中文字幕| 欧美肥大bbwbbw高潮| 成a人片国产精品| 亚洲动漫第一页| 亚洲天天做日日做天天谢日日欢 | 亚洲激情在线激情| 26uuu精品一区二区在线观看| caoporn国产一区二区| 激情av综合网| 91九色最新地址| 亚洲高清不卡在线观看| 久久国产精品色| 欧美日韩一区二区在线观看| 日韩精品在线一区二区| 国产精品久久久久久久久免费相片 | 制服丝袜一区二区三区| 欧美激情一区二区三区四区| 不卡的av在线播放| 天天做天天摸天天爽国产一区| 成人网页在线观看| 亚洲国产日产av| 国产午夜精品理论片a级大结局| 91在线码无精品| 亚洲一区二区三区在线| 欧美日韩一区二区在线视频| 极品少妇xxxx精品少妇| 久久午夜色播影院免费高清| 久久精品国产精品亚洲综合| 久久久综合九色合综国产精品| 久久69国产一区二区蜜臀| 中文字幕日韩一区二区| 欧美sm极限捆绑bd| 亚洲综合无码一区二区| 伊人色综合久久天天人手人婷| 国产一区二区电影| 国产在线一区二区| 欧美日韩成人一区| 成人欧美一区二区三区在线播放| 在线观看免费一区| 国产成人在线免费| 免费成人在线网站| 日韩成人一级片| 激情图片小说一区| 日韩中文字幕麻豆| 国模无码大尺度一区二区三区 | 一本久久a久久免费精品不卡| 亚洲第一主播视频| 午夜电影久久久| 精品一区二区三区免费毛片爱| 国产露脸91国语对白| 国产一区二区成人久久免费影院| 成人免费福利片| 日韩美女视频一区二区| 免费在线观看视频一区| 精品亚洲porn| 欧美精品电影在线播放| 26uuu亚洲| 国产精品66部| 欧美日韩一区二区在线观看| 久久精品夜色噜噜亚洲a∨ |